Перейти к публикации

Создание машинной визуализации


JIexaHT

Рекомендованные сообщения

Здравствуйте! Подскажите кто в теме) Создал модель станка, законвертил все в stl, создал vmid, дошло дело до создания файла XML, а он собака не создается. Работаю в CS17, в предыдущих версиях он автоматом создавался после нажатия ПКМ на имени станка в файле vmid и вылазило соответствующее окошко, но сейчас у меня создаваться не хочет (скрин в комплекте)! Может я что то не поставил или это сейчас по другому создается??? HELP!!! В рукопашку чет не очень пилить, если деталей много будет, употеешься.

joxi_screenshot_1512108019291.png

Ссылка на сообщение
Поделиться на других сайтах


2 минуты назад, JIexaHT сказал:

Подскажите кто в теме) Создал модель станка, законвертил все в stl

А в mashsim вы эти все сохраненные элементы STL собрали и определили кинематику станка ?

 

Безымянный.png

Ссылка на сообщение
Поделиться на других сайтах
6 минут назад, JIexaHT сказал:

надо собирать а xml нет

вы собираете станок все определяете и нажимаете сохранить и в папке где лежат части станка должен появится xml файл! Он появляется после сборки станка, а уже после этого подгоняете под него файл станка!

 

Снимок.PNG

Изменено пользователем Frezer_PU
Ссылка на сообщение
Поделиться на других сайтах
1 час назад, Frezer_PU сказал:

вы собираете станок все определяете и нажимаете сохранить и в папке где лежат части станка должен появится xml файл! Он появляется после сборки станка, а уже после этого подгоняете под него файл станка!

 

Снимок.PNG

Спасибо! Разобрался с этим)  Буду собирать!

Схема станка вот такая! 5 осей, С-стол и В-голова поворачивается. Чтобы пилить gpp под него, решил начать с машинной визуализации, чтоб видеть как он реагировать будет

Сборка станка.JPG

Ссылка на сообщение
Поделиться на других сайтах
15 часов назад, JIexaHT сказал:

Спасибо! Разобрался с этим)  Буду собирать!

Схема станка вот такая! 5 осей, С-стол и В-голова поворачивается. Чтобы пилить gpp под него, решил начать с машинной визуализации, чтоб видеть как он реагировать будет

 

Кого то вы мне напоминаете =).... Пишите если вдруг еще возникнут вопросы =)

Ссылка на сообщение
Поделиться на других сайтах

Вопрос к пользователям solidcam , кто нибудь более глубоко вникал в симуляцию от mw ? а именно в визуализацию по "псевдо"  G коду , возможно у кого нибудь есть более обширная информация и о контроле доп. осей через препроцессор на питоне (поддерживаемые команды). Думаю у solidcam есть те же возможности.

 

Черновик 

5a224053bb3ad_.thumb.png.0a9ad5b30bfd47b044072561167bbfb9.png

Hide  
Ссылка на сообщение
Поделиться на других сайтах

@Frezer_PU Можете подсказать?! Что я не так делаю? После компоновки в в machsim сместил ось вращения В по Z вверх, там где и должно быть вращение, в machsim все норм работает, но  VMID ругается на это и не дает сохранить. 

станок.jpg

vmid.jpg

Ссылка на сообщение
Поделиться на других сайтах

Выкладывайте в облако файл станка и сборку для машсим с файлом XML давайте ссылку и будем разбираться ! 

Ссылка на сообщение
Поделиться на других сайтах

@JIexaHT попробуйте в шпинделе поставить такое же значение как и в оси вращения В 335.000

ошибка пропадает но при симуляции шпиндель падает в стол при том что деталь поднята над ним, возможно у вас как-то не правильно подгружены STL части, в общем попробуйте ! 

Скрытый текст

a883a12beb9a2459596d6e1965e21a53.png

 

Ссылка на сообщение
Поделиться на других сайтах

Перерыл много информации, но так ничего стоящего не нашел. Задам вопрос тут, может кто сталкивался, либо в курсе как это можно сделать.

Как описать магазин инструментов (барабан) в файле станка (vmd).  В шпинделе у меня 1 станция на инструмент и он корректно отображается, но как добавить в файл станка сам магазин в котором находятся все остальные инструменты которые используются в проекте. Либо сделать по аналогии с  токарным станком и создать второй "шпиндель " с остальным количеством станций и завязать его на не используемую ось. Есть у кого какие соображения или наработки в этом вопросе? 

Ссылка на сообщение
Поделиться на других сайтах
  • 7 месяцев спустя...
4 часа назад, uniloor сказал:

Где в ModuleWorks находится меню, то что справа на изображении?

4526fa60bab073919a7969603d78cc52.png

Изменено пользователем Frezer_PU
Ссылка на сообщение
Поделиться на других сайтах
  • 3 недели спустя...
В 08.12.2017 в 19:58, Ishimtcev сказал:

Перерыл много информации, но так ничего стоящего не нашел. Задам вопрос тут, может кто сталкивался, либо в курсе как это можно сделать.

Как описать магазин инструментов (барабан) в файле станка (vmd).  В шпинделе у меня 1 станция на инструмент и он корректно отображается, но как добавить в файл станка сам магазин в котором находятся все остальные инструменты которые используются в проекте. Либо сделать по аналогии с  токарным станком и создать второй "шпиндель " с остальным количеством станций и завязать его на не используемую ось. Есть у кого какие соображения или наработки в этом вопросе? 

для чего??? 

Ссылка на сообщение
Поделиться на других сайтах
2 часа назад, NickEL1000 сказал:

для чего??? 

 Я понимаю что это балавство, но все же хочется добиться отображения инструмента в магазине. По крайней мере в файле станка существует функция магазин инструментов. Да и станок у меня маленький и зонтик с инструментом висит очень низко. 

Ссылка на сообщение
Поделиться на других сайтах
21 час назад, Ishimtcev сказал:

 Я понимаю что это балавство, но все же хочется добиться отображения инструмента в магазине. По крайней мере в файле станка существует функция магазин инструментов. Да и станок у меня маленький и зонтик с инструментом висит очень низко. 

отнюдь не баловство, правильно поставленное ТЗ это половина решения задачи

 

Ссылка на сообщение
Поделиться на других сайтах
  • 3 месяца спустя...
  • 5 месяцев спустя...

Здравствуйте! помогите или подскажите пожалуйста как создать машина для солидкам  с stl файлам станок токарно-фрезерной HASS ST-30Y только не все файлы удается отправить могу на почта отправить.

15_A2-8_Chuck(EXTEND).STL

HASS ST-30Y.xml

LT.STL

Tailstock.STL

Y.STL

Z.STL

 
 
  •  
Изменено пользователем akmal
Ссылка на сообщение
Поделиться на других сайтах
  • 2 месяца спустя...
Илларионов_Игнат

 Screenshot_0
Как-к :
Solidcam Моделирование Машины
Строить


Screenshot_1
Шаг 1. построение графической модели


Screenshot_2
Шаг 2. сгруппируйте их по функциональным блокам
например, эта группа портала
будет назначен в качестве оси Y


Screenshot_3
сделать все
затем сохраните каждый блок как один .файл STL 
очень низкое разрешение ободрено для цели имитации


Screenshot_4
for this machine, I need 4 components only
X,Y,Z and a table


Screenshot_5
обратите внимание, где графика
происхождение находится


Screenshot_6
позиция компонентов решается здесь,
таким образом, центр распределения компонентов равен 0,0,0


Screenshot_7
и 0,0,0-это именно то, где solidcam будет
положите держатели инструмента и инструменты


Screenshot_7
Шаг 3. сделать новый файл ВМИД 
давайте использовать какой-либо из образец вмид файлов,
под пользователями / public/solidcam / solidcam 20xx/gpptool


Screenshot_9
дважды щелкните файл Midi, то это
утилита будет открыта


Screenshot_10
создание совершенно новой машины


Screenshot_11
вот новая машина,
базовый шаблон для типичной 4-осевой машины.
В этом дереве можно перетаскивать, добавлять или удалять основные компоненты.


Screenshot_12
Вроде этого. Видишь разницу? В этой машине портала, С / З
блоки прикрепленные к двигая блоку.
Затем идет X-travel unit, а затем Z unit.


Screenshot_13
перетащил таблицу в корневое положение, как этот ЧПУ
не имеет поворотной оси, затем удаляется ось A


Screenshot_14
каждая ось имеет важные атрибуты, поэтому внимательно прочитайте и установите
цифры в соответствии с вашими потребностями
после этого вид готов


Screenshot_15
Шаг. 4. Файл моделирования машины (XML)
как совершенно новый файл vmid, имя моделирования машины
быть пуст. раскрывающийся список и щелкните любой


Screenshot_16
а затем откройте его


Screenshot_17
это модуль имитации машины который будет
называется, когда вы на самом деле запустить машину solidcam 
моделирование в SolidWorks


Screenshot_18
нажмите кнопку Изменить машину


Screenshot_19
и сохраните как совершенно новую машину, под новой папкой
местонахождение : c://users/public/documents/solidcam/
solideam20xx / таблицы/MachSim / xml


Screenshot_20
мы будем использовать различные компоненты машины,
поэтому удалите все, кроме xml и
скопируйте файлы STL, созданные ранее


Screenshot_21
вы следили?
если нет, вернитесь туда, где вы потерялись...

Screenshot_22
Шаг. 5. заключительный этап
если вы открыли новый файл из этого окна, вы не
увидеть любую структуру, потому что мы удалили все, не волнуйтесь


Screenshot_23
удалить здесь снова, я имею в виду все


Screenshot_24
нейминг-это важно


Screenshot_25
добавьте первый фиксированную структуру, в этом
случай низкопробная рамка / таблица


Screenshot_26
выделить таблицу. stl под новой папкой, в том же месте
как xml, да это то, что вы сделали раньше, по вашим потребностям

Screenshot_27
Тэда? )))))


Screenshot_28
добавить ось Y

Screenshot_29
и приложите свою геометрию согласно нашему
предыдущий сделанный файл stl оси y

Screenshot_30
кроме того, добавить по оси X, по оси Y, потому что X-это ребенок
Ю. Это может варьироваться в зависимости от геометрии машины.


Screenshot_31
каждая ось имеет свои собственные атрибуты, вектор оси / пределы перемещения
установите его на ваш размер


Screenshot_32
после того как все оси прикреплены, время положить логический блок инструмента.
под веретеном. щелкните правой кнопкой мыши ось z,
добавить динамический элемент, выбрать набор инструментов

Screenshot_33
теперь вы видите это под Z, это где solidcam будет
положите инструмент / беседку / держатель автоматически всякий раз, когда вы
запустите машинное моделирование.

Screenshot_34
кроме того, позволяет добавить логическое устройство заготовки под корень
потому что в этой установке заготовки не двигаются вообще

Screenshot_35
Я рекомендую, чтобы скрыть начального запаса.
а потом спасем. все сделано.

Screenshot_33
теперь вернемся к папке gpptool,
щелкните файл vmid, созданный ранее,
выберите новую машину, опубликуйте, затем сохраните

Screenshot_37
если solidcam не активен, введите параметры solidcam
ваша правая панель на экране SW,
выберите новоиспеченную машину


Screenshot_38
позволяет сделать часть, сделать коды,
затем запустите машинное моделирование


Screenshot_39
увеличение/уменьшение, поворот, включение/выключение запасы, траектории и т. д.
Наслаждайтесь!!!!


 

Screenshot_0.jpg

Screenshot_1.jpg

Screenshot_2.jpg

Screenshot_3.jpg

Screenshot_4.jpg

Screenshot_5.jpg

Screenshot_6.jpg

Screenshot_7.jpg

Screenshot_8.jpg

Screenshot_9.jpg

Screenshot_10.jpg

Screenshot_11.jpg

Screenshot_12.jpg

Screenshot_13.jpg

Screenshot_14.jpg

Screenshot_15.jpg

Screenshot_16.jpg

Screenshot_17.jpg

Screenshot_18.jpg

Screenshot_19.jpg

Screenshot_20.jpg

Screenshot_21.jpg

Screenshot_22.jpg

Screenshot_23.jpg

Screenshot_24.jpg

Screenshot_25.jpg

Screenshot_26.jpg

Screenshot_27.jpg

Screenshot_28.jpg

Screenshot_29.jpg

Screenshot_30.jpg

Screenshot_31.jpg

Screenshot_32.jpg

Screenshot_33.jpg

Screenshot_34.jpg

Screenshot_35.jpg

Screenshot_36.jpg

Последние три Screenshot не влезли, ошибка при загрузке:5a33a3681a26d_3DSmiles(26):

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




  • Сообщения

    • lux59
      построить дугами барашку я пробовал, не то слегка, он в списке выдаст количество сегментов, да норм сделаю покажу, что вышло, правда пришлось делать сборкой не единой деталью, в общем я понял как это работает, Спасибо за помощь!
    • lem_on
      Ага, особенно некоторых бестолочей со своим пониманием реальности.  По типу, я скачал программу, я так вижу, я пишу книгу. 
    • malvi.dp
      Так в чем проблема создать кривую и протянуть профиль? Единственная трудность это кривую сделать из дуг и отрезков, а не сплайном. Если же не использовать инструментарий сварных конструкций, то можно и сплайн использовать в качестве направляющей.  
    • Alexey0336
      Добрый день. Как то фигурировал тут вопрос с точкой в названии файла. У меня проблема, не могу захватить модель, пишет, что с этим символом нельзя. Обойти никак нельзя получается?
    • malvi.dp
      У вас там скорее всего скрыты размеры. Перетяните их дальше от штриховки, чтоб не пересекали.
    • Snake 60
      @Бестолковый С названием топика не ошиблись? Человек спрашивает: ' VBA ' 1. Open a document in SOLIDWORKS. ' 2. Run the macro below to set inch units with '     a fractional base of 16 and no rounding. Dim swApp As SldWorks.SldWorks Dim Part As SldWorks.ModelDoc2 Option Explicit Sub main()    Set swApp = Application.SldWorks    Set Part = swApp.ActiveDoc    Part.SetUnits swINCHES, swFRACTION, 16, 0, False End Sub   Код взят отсюда: https://help.solidworks.com/2019/english/api/sldworksapi/solidworks.interop.sldworks~solidworks.interop.sldworks.imodeldoc2~setunits.html Вот еще описание всех методов: https://help.solidworks.com/2021/English/api/swconst/DP_Units.htm Ну и на вкусное, статья от Артема (см. через ВПН) https://www.google.com/url?sa=t&source=web&rct=j&opi=89978449&url=https://www.codestack.net/solidworks-api/options/document/set-units/&ved=2ahUKEwjgpL-apN6GAxU7HxAIHYO0D2IQFnoECBAQAQ&usg=AOvVaw15xq49gocoVQ5BzEA31qGf
    • Shvg
      IModelDocExtension.SetUserPreferenceInteger(swUserPreferenceIntegerValue_e.swUnitSystem, swUserPreferenceOption_e.swDetailingNoOptionSpecified, swUnitSystem_e.<Value>), где swUnitSystem_e.<Value> перечисление swUnitSystem_CGS           1 = Centimeter, gram, second  swUnitSystem_Custom        4 = Lets you set length units, density units, and force  swUnitSystem_IPS           3 = Inch, pound, second  swUnitSystem_MKS           2 = Meter, kilogram, second  swUnitSystem_MMGS          5 = Millimeter, gram, second   
    • Ветерок
      Вопрос про "включение RGK". Если в модели какие-то функции сделаны с использованием RGK, эта модель будет работоспособной на другом компе, где RGK "не включен"? И вообще не понятно, получается система использует два разных ядра одновременно? Или включая RGK, автоматически выключается Прасолид? А обратно переключиться можно? Если можно итак, и так, и туда, и обратно, тогда не понятно зачем вообще это включение-выключение.
    • TVM
      Так на скорую руку строились. Ясно что такое воспроизвести в живую затруднительно. 
    • Борман
×
×
  • Создать...